- Abstract:
The Data Collection and Organization (DC&O) text module provides background on useful, general-purpose software tools. The aim is to discuss types of generic software that virtually every well-equipped scientist uses. This includes: spreadsheets, database programs, statistics packages, graphics programs, and word processors.
DC&O includes several examples of the use of these tools in biology. These include 'An Embryological Example with Tips and Tricks' and the complete text and dataset of a classic evolutionary study published in 1899 by Hermon Bumpus ('The Elimination of the Unfit as Illustrated by the Introduced Sparrow, Passer domesticus'). The Bumpus data can be used to investigate problems in natural selection.
